Stratified Columnar Epithelium
A type of epithelial tissue composed of several layers of column-shaped cells, designed to protect or secrete substances.
Oblique Section
A type of anatomical slice or section that is cut at an angle to the main axis of an organ or part of the body, providing a view that is between transverse and longitudinal.
Histological Sections
Histological sections are thin slices of tissue prepared for examination under a microscope to study the microanatomy of cells and tissues.
Tissue
Groups of cells with similar structures and functions that work together to perform specific activities in the body.
